Adam Hadwin’s club smash backfire was the worst in history. In his second round at the Valspar Championship on Friday, the 37-year-old had just double-bogeyed the tenth hole.
At three over par, he was virtually guaranteed to miss the cut. And it seemed the Canadian’s frustration reached a breaking point. He walloped his club into the rough as Hadwin stormed off the green in rage. Unfortunately for the furious Valspar champion of 2017, he released more than just steam.
That’s when the University of Louisville product took a big cut in the thick rough just off the green and hit a sprinkler head, which immediately turned the irrigation on. His reaction after the hit was fantastic, a mixture of unresolved anger and humility.
